If you're the kind of person who notices when something's not working and fixes it before anyone asks, this role was built for you.

Our client is a commercial strategy and insight consultancy at an exciting inflection point. Following a significant merger, they’re building out their operational backbone — and they need someone who can bring clarity, structure, and momentum to the day-to-day running of the business.

Why join? This is a genuine career opportunity. You’ll be stepping into a business that’s growing, with real visibility and a clear path toward a senior ops role. You’ll work closely with leadership, across the full breadth of the business, and you’ll have the space to shape how things are done.

The day-to-day:

  • Resourcing and capacity planning across project teams
  • Freelancer management — sourcing, coordinating, day-to-day support
  • BAU project coordination and process improvement
  • Budget tracking and flagging overspend or missed payments
  • Vendor and supplier management
  • Onboarding support for new team members

The Candidate: You’ve got agency experience and a solid operational grounding. You’re comfortable holding lots of moving pieces at once, you communicate clearly, and you know how to prioritise when everything feels urgent. You’re ambitious — this isn’t a role you want to stay in forever, and that’s exactly the point. Experience coordinating qualitative research projects (setting up interviews, managing fieldwork logistics) would be a real bonus.
